Intel Xeon Platinum 8376H or Intel Celeron 1047UE - which processor is faster? In this comparison we look at the differences and analyze which of these two CPUs is better. We compare the technical data and benchmark results.

The Intel Xeon Platinum 8376H has 28 cores with 56 threads and clocks with a maximum frequency of 4.30 GHz. Up to 1146 GB of memory is supported in 6 memory channels. The Intel Xeon Platinum 8376H was released in Q2/2020.

The Intel Celeron 1047UE has 2 cores with 2 threads and clocks with a maximum frequency of 1.40 GHz. The CPU supports up to 16 GB of memory in 2 memory channels. The Intel Celeron 1047UE was released in Q1/2013.

Memory & PCIe

The Intel Xeon Platinum 8376H can use up to 1146 GB of memory in 6 memory channels. The maximum memory bandwidth is 153.6 GB/s. The Intel Celeron 1047UE supports up to 16 GB of memory in 2 memory channels and achieves a memory bandwidth of up to 25.6 GB/s.

Thermal Management

The thermal design power (TDP for short) of the Intel Xeon Platinum 8376H is 205 W, while the Intel Celeron 1047UE has a TDP of 17 W. The TDP specifies the necessary cooling solution that is required to cool the processor sufficiently.

Technical details

The Intel Xeon Platinum 8376H is manufactured in 14 nm and has 38.50 MB cache. The Intel Celeron 1047UE is manufactured in 22 nm and has a 2.00 MB cache.
